Output 15609507b9436e06eb4a87e91f463489dcf4a3d02fe381fd8bb3ac71b78ec425:1
- value
- 25907266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ae0fccd631bd033cdb8c044be967a838c0a78043 OP_EQUAL
- address
- 3HZNRjcKFZvFMiFxUaB34TwYyCwoxQW1dY
- transaction
- 15609507b9436e06eb4a87e91f463489dcf4a3d02fe381fd8bb3ac71b78ec425
- confirmations
- 357310
- spent
- true